What Is Nominal GDP?

When a country counts up the value of everything it makes and sells in a year from cars and software to haircuts and healthcare it gets a raw number. This raw, unadjusted total is called nominal Gross Domestic Product. It measures the total economic output using the current prices of goods and services at the exact time they were produced.

Because it uses current prices, this nominal figure can grow for two very different reasons: either the economy actually produced more goods, or the same goods simply got more expensive. This makes it a tricky measure of true prosperity.

Imagine an economy that only sells apples. In year one, it produces 100 apples and sells them for $1 each, making its nominal output $100. In year two, a drought hits. The economy only produces 80 apples, but the shortage drives the price up to $2 an apple.

The nominal output for year two is now $160 (80 apples × $2). On paper, the nominal economy grew by 60%. In reality, the country has fewer apples to eat. The growth was entirely driven by higher prices.

Real vs Nominal GDP: What Is the Difference?

To understand if an economy is actually getting stronger, you have to separate real output from rising prices. Real GDP strips out the effect of changing prices to measure actual physical production and the true purchasing power of an economy over time.

By anchoring prices to a specific past year known as the base year, real metrics allow for an apples-to-apples comparison across decades. If you measure 2024's production using 2012's prices, you can see exactly how much the volume of output has changed, completely ignoring any price hikes that happened in between.

How Inflation Changes the Math

To remove the noise of rising prices from the national accounts, economists use a specific mathematical tool called the GDP deflator.

The deflator is a ratio that tracks how much the prices of all domestically produced goods and services have changed compared to the base year. The official data and definitions for this in the US are maintained by the US Bureau of Economic Analysis.

The formula to find the real number is straightforward:

Real GDP = (Nominal GDP / GDP Deflator) × 100

When inflation runs hot, the deflator grows, which shrinks the "real" value of the nominal growth. For example, if nominal output grows by 6% over a year, but the prices of goods across the economy rise by 4%, the real growth is roughly just 2%.

The deflator is slightly different from consumer inflation measures because it covers everything the country produces, including heavy industrial machinery and government defense spending, not just the items a typical household buys.

In the rare case of falling prices across an economy (deflation), real growth can actually outpace the nominal number, because the same amount of money now buys a larger volume of goods.

What This Spread Tells the Market

Traders and policymakers watch the gap between these two metrics closely because it reveals the underlying mechanics of the business cycle.

If nominal output is climbing fast but real output is flat or shrinking, it flashes a warning sign for stagflation a state where prices rise but actual economic activity stalls. This is the worst-case scenario for a central bank.

If the real economy is running too hot and driving up prices, a central bank will typically hike interest rates to cool borrowing and spending. But if real growth stalls while nominal prices keep rising, policymakers face a hard choice: hike rates to fight prices and risk causing a deep recession, or cut rates to support growth and risk letting prices spiral further out of control.

Financial markets react sharply to this spread. Stock markets often struggle when real growth slows, because companies are selling fewer actual products, even if higher prices are artificially keeping their total revenue numbers up for a short time.

Common Mistakes

  • Mistaking nominal growth for true prosperity: It is easy to see a 5% jump in nominal output and assume the economy is booming. But if everyday prices rose by 7% during that same time period, the average citizen's actual standard of living went backward.
  • Ignoring the base year: Real metrics are always tied to the prices of a specific past year. If you forget this, historical comparisons lose their meaning. You cannot directly compare a real output number based on 2012 prices with one based on 2017 prices without adjusting the math first.
